Output d3216a633b77784eaa2252f6ad31fb187cce5e4923c86d7c580c0ae49d9cf5f2:1

value
28584
script pubkey
OP_0 OP_PUSHBYTES_20 d306c11f1fdad905840bd18caf645ad7fd02f699
address
tb1q6vrvz8clmtvstpqt6xx27ez66l7s9a5enh09k4
transaction
d3216a633b77784eaa2252f6ad31fb187cce5e4923c86d7c580c0ae49d9cf5f2
confirmations
69329
spent
true